Why Hire a Trade Show Magician?

Exhibition halls are brutal. Hundreds of booths compete for the same tired attendees who have seen every demo reel and branded stress ball imaginable. Studies from the exhibition industry suggest exhibitors have roughly three to five seconds to capture a visitor's attention before they walk past.

A trade show magician changes the equation entirely. Instead of hoping people stop, you give them a reason they can't ignore a live, interactive experience that fuses entertainment with your sales message.

The result is not just a crowd. It is a crowd that stays, listens, laughs, and hands over a business card before they leave. That is the difference between a cost-of-attendance line item and a measurable return on your trade-show investment.

But not every magician understands the dynamics of a B2B exhibition floor. Trade-show magic is a discipline of its own: fast cycles, rotating micro-audiences, seamless handoffs to your sales team, and a script that highlights your product not the performer's ego. It shares DNA with corporate event entertainment but operates under completely different constraints.

Why Most Exhibition Booths Get Walked Past

The five-second verdict
arrow

Every exhibition hall tells the same story: hundreds of stands competing for the same crowd, most armed with identical strategies — free pens, screen loops, awkward eye contact from sales staff waiting for someone to stop. The average visitor spends under five seconds deciding whether to approach a booth or keep walking.

Busy trade show floor with rows of exhibition booths and attendees walking past without stopping
The only format that forces a cognitive stop
arrow

A trade show magician changes that equation entirely. Magic is the only live entertainment format that forces a complete cognitive stop. People don't glance at a card trick — they freeze, lean in, and stay. That pause is your sales window. And unlike a product demo that only attracts people already in-market, magic pulls in anyone passing by, widening your top of funnel dramatically.

How far in advance should I book a trade show magician?

Plus Sign

For major European exhibitions (MWC, Web Summit, EPHJ, EBACE…), it is best to book six to eight weeks before the event. This leaves time for the custom-script phase and at least one rehearsal call. For smaller regional trade fairs, three to four weeks is usually sufficient.

Can you integrate our specific product or sales message into your act?

Plus Sign

Absolutely. That is the whole point. Isma works from a custom script built around your product features, tagline, or campaign theme. Past integrations have covered topics like AI platforms, cybersecurity solutions, luxury watchmaking, and pharmaceutical innovations.

How much space do you need in our booth?

Plus Sign

For close-up walk-around magic, zero additional space is required — Isma works within your existing layout. For podium presentations, a small area of roughly 2 m × 2 m at the front of your stand is ideal. Stage shows require a standard stage setup with sound.

What if our booth is small (3×3 m)?
Plus Sign

Close-up mentalism is designed for exactly this scenario. No stage, no sound system, no extra footprint.

Isma engages visitors one-on-one or in groups of three to five, creating intimate moments that are often more powerful than a big stage show.
